Session 1

Improve Your Consult Skills and Improve the Outlook for Both Your Patients and Your Business

Effective communication is a critical skill for veterinary nurses – if your clients don’t understand and engage with your recommendations, not only will treatment compliance levels be low (ultimately affecting patient outcomes) but also, your clients won’t trust that your practice is the best choice for their beloved pet or horse.

In this session we will explore client expectations – in the context of the wider world, today’s consumers have higher standards, greater choice and a lower tolerance for poor service. Participants will learn some basic principles of communication, including the role of verbal versus non-verbal communication, along with how the effective receipt of a message differs according to the state of mind and circumstances of the client (frustrated / worried / angry / grateful owners require different approaches). We’ll also look at examples from industry and other service sectors.

Learning outcomes:

  • Understanding how to communicate effectively with owners in a range of different situations
  • Making the link between more effective communication and improved patient outcomes
  • Identifying where better communication will deliver positive financial benefits for the practice
Session 2

The ‘7 Steps’ to Better Consults

In this session we will look at the Calgary-Cambridge communication model used in UK medical schools, and on which the ‘7 steps’ consultation skills model is based. Whatever your natural style, great consult communication can be learned, and the ‘7 steps’ model is a proven way to improve both business and patient outcomes with a simple process. Using this model, nurses will find that even difficult consults with tricky clients can be managed effectively and efficiently.

Learning outcomes:

  • Understanding how to use the seven steps in daily working life
  • Acquiring practical skills and techniques to get the most out of clients in the limited time available in the consult room
  • Being able to identify examples of both good and bad communication behaviours in colleagues, and give feedback accordingly
Session 3

Keeping Standards High with Consistently Excellent Consult Skills

Once you have learned how to communicate effectively and optimise the consult experience, it’s vital that you continue to provide the same great service to every client, every day. It’s easy to slip into bad habits, or to forget new ones, and so nurses must review their performance regularly and make any refinements as required. We never stop learning, and we must never feel that learning new skills stops once the course is over – personal development is a continual process.

In this session we will explore some useful methods of assessing performance and measuring progress towards personal goals. These include:

  • Individual review – both informally by yourself, and formally with your manager as part of an appraisal or development review
  • Peer / group reviews. Team meetings or training days are great places to share learnings and give feedback
  • Audio-visual assessment. Filming consults and watching them back is a very effective way to gain real insight into performance
  • Consult index. A new quantitative tool to benchmark performance

Learning outcomes:

  • Making time for regular progress reviews
  • Setting goals and SMART objectives for yourself
  • Understanding the importance of seeking honest feedback from colleagues (as well as giving it back in return)
